InstaNavigation and StoriesDown are both free, web-based tools for viewing Instagram stories from public accounts — no login, no app, no account required. People compare them because they overlap heavily, but they make different trade-offs: InstaNavigation is the broader browsing tool with highlights support, while StoriesDown is built around downloading. The deciding factor, as always with free scrapers, is which one actually loads when you need it.

This comparison covers how each tool hides your identity, what the ad experience feels like, how they handle highlights and downloads, and the reliability question that haunts every free Instagram viewer.

InstaNavigation vs StoriesDown overview

Both tools solve the same core problem: watching a public account’s stories without logging in and without appearing in that account’s viewer list. Both run server-side, so their infrastructure — not your device or Instagram account — fetches the content from Instagram.

InstaNavigation (instanavigation.com) presents itself as a general anonymous viewer. It supports active stories, highlights, and basic profile browsing, and it has kept a fairly stable domain. The browsing experience is its priority, with downloads available as a secondary feature.

StoriesDown (storiesdown.com) is download-first. The UI foregrounds “search, then download,” and per-frame downloads are its strongest feature. It handles active stories but lacks reliable highlights support, and it tends to be slower to load.

Anonymity: how both tools work

Both InstaNavigation and StoriesDown use server-side proxying. When you search a username, the tool’s servers fetch the stories from Instagram — not your browser, not your IP, not your Instagram account. The target account sees a request from the tool’s infrastructure, and your identity never reaches their viewer list.

What you get with both: no appearance in the viewer list, no login required, and no way for the target to identify you. What neither guarantees: anonymity to the tool itself, since neither publishes a clear privacy or data-retention policy. You are anonymous to the Instagram account, but not necessarily to the operator — equally true for both.

And neither can view private accounts. Private stories are restricted to approved followers and enforced on Instagram’s servers, so no third-party tool can bypass it. Any site promising private viewing is a scam.

Ads, speed, and reliability

InstaNavigation runs a moderate ad load — mostly banners with some interstitials — and has shown reasonably good uptime for a free scraper, though it is not immune to outages. For troubleshooting it, see InstaNavigation not working.

StoriesDown also runs ads, heaviest on the download path since ad networks attach interstitials to download buttons. It is generally slower, and videos sometimes return only a thumbnail — usually an expired CDN token that a fresh search resolves.

Because the two fail at different times for different reasons, they make decent backups for each other. The underlying reality is the same for both: no free scraper can guarantee availability, because they all operate at Instagram’s sufferance.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are InstaNavigation and StoriesDown the same tool?

No. They are separate tools run by different operators. InstaNavigation is a broader viewer with highlights and basic profile browsing, while StoriesDown is download-focused and skips reliable highlights. They share the same anonymity model but are not interchangeable.

Can either tool view private Instagram accounts?

No. Both work only on public accounts. Private stories are restricted to approved followers and enforced on Instagram’s servers, so no third-party tool can access them. Any site claiming otherwise is a scam.

Which is more reliable?

InstaNavigation has generally shown steadier uptime than StoriesDown, which is slower and more inconsistent. That said, both are free scrapers exposed to Instagram blocking shared IP ranges, so neither is guaranteed — keeping both as backups is wise.

Will the account know I viewed their story?

No. Both fetch stories server-side, so your account never interacts with the story and you do not appear in the viewer list. You stay anonymous to the account, though not necessarily to the tool’s operator.
